#6bc4eb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6bc4eb is composed of 42% red, 76.9% green and 92.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.5% cyan, 16.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 198.3 degrees, a saturation of 76.2% and a lightness of 67.1%. #6bc4eb color hex could be obtained by blending #d6ffff with #0089d7. Closest websafe color is: #66ccff.

Shades and Tints of #6bc4eb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010608 is the darkest color, while #f5fb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#6bc4eb

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a5adb1 is the less saturated color, while #58ccfe is the most saturated one.
